The Asian Development Bank (ADB) is backing a major 3 GWh solar project in the Solomon Islands with a comprehensive funding package. This initiative is a critical step for a nation where renewables currently account for only 2% of the energy mix. The project is expected to slash electricity generation costs by an average of 58% and propel the Solomon Islands Electricity Authority (Solomon Power) toward its ambitious goal of generating 100% of its electricity from renewable sources by 2030.
Solomon Islands solar project Overview
The project, named the Solomon Islands Renewable Energy Project, will install at least 3 GWh of solar generation capacity, complemented by a battery energy storage system (BESS). This new infrastructure, with facilities planned for the Guadalcanal and Malaita provinces, will replace the nation’s reliance on expensive and environmentally harmful diesel-based electricity generation.
The introduction of solar power is projected to reduce electricity generation costs significantly, saving Solomon Power approximately $4.6 million annually. ADB’s Role in the Solomon Islands solar project
The Asian Development Bank (ADB) has been instrumental in bringing the Solomon Islands Renewable Energy Project to fruition. Rather than a single loan, the ADB has facilitated a multi-faceted funding package. This includes a $10 million loan from the ADB, a $5 million grant from the Asian Development Fund, and $10 million in co-financing from the Saudi Fund for Development.
The ADB has been a long-standing partner of the Solomon Islands in its efforts to improve its energy infrastructure. This latest project is a key part of the ADB’s broader strategy to support sustainable development and climate resilience across the Pacific region.

Future Prospects for the Solomon Islands solar project
The successful implementation of this solar project is expected to pave the way for further investments in renewable energy in the Solomon Islands. It is a vital piece of a larger puzzle, complementing other major initiatives like the Tina River Hydropower Project, which is set to supply 68% of the renewable energy to the capital Honiara’s grid. Together, these projects create a clear and viable path toward the 2030 goal.
